Special opportunity to own a large parcel of Morgan County land, in the quaint and historic Apalachee Community. With a total of 231.98 acres, this property is comprised of a mix of pasture and forest, including hay fields, a dove field, and natural woodlands of mature pines and hardwoods. Long Branch, which flows into the Apalachee River, as well as a small pond, provide beautiful water features. Abundant wildlife, privacy, and lovely home site options afford you the opportunity to enjoy this parcel as a recreational/hunting retreat, income-producing timberland, or to build your forever home. Property includes a 4BR/3BA home with full basement, in-ground pool, and two barns. Property is in a 10-year Conservation Use Rural Land Covenant (2023). Proximity to beautiful historic Madison, Lake Oconee, and Athens, home of the University of Georgia.
